Output d419730993d56d90f09e20ceb20ee39c577ac39426badeee05cc9d483a7a8866:1

value
1412265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08c8acb6c516c2607d69451e487bac87e8e721b9 OP_EQUAL
address
32VTjCTwbhaVff65SxP9yRAfY6yVejrk1T
transaction
d419730993d56d90f09e20ceb20ee39c577ac39426badeee05cc9d483a7a8866
confirmations
253175
spent
true